SOUTH SAN FRANCISCO, Calif., Nov. 6 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Renovis, Inc. (NASDAQ:RNVS), a biopharmaceutical company focused on the discovery and development of drugs for major medical needs in the areas of neurological and inflammatory diseases, today announced financial results for the third quarter ended September 30, 2007. Revenue for the third quarter and the nine months ended September 30, 2007 was $1.3 million and $8.5 million, respectively, compared to $2.2 million and $8.3 million in the corresponding periods in 2006. All of the revenue earned in the three- and nine-month periods of 2007 related to our collaboration with Pfizer Inc. to research, develop and commercialize small molecules that target the vanilloid receptor, or VR1. The decrease in revenue in the three months ended September 30, 2007 resulted from a change in the amortization period for the upfront license payment that Renovis received from Pfizer in 2005 in connection with the initiation of the collaboration. Following the amendment of that agreement earlier this year to extend the term of the collaboration for an additional year, the amortization period for the upfront license payment was extended, reducing the amount of upfront license fee revenue recognized in each of the first three quarters of 2007. The increase in revenue in the nine months ended September 30, 2007 resulted primarily from the Company's recognition of milestone revenue of $4.5 million from Pfizer partially offset by a decrease in revenue resulting from the revised amortization period as described above. In the corresponding period in 2006 the Company earned $1.5 million in milestone revenue related to the Pfizer collaboration. Research and development expenses for the third quarter and nine months ended September 30, 2007 were $5.9 million and $20.1 million, respectively, compared to $6.9 million and $20.7 million during the same periods in 2006. The decrease in the third quarter of 2007 as compared to the corresponding period in 2006 resulted primarily from cost savings generated by the restructuring undertaken in January 2007. The decrease in the nine month period ended 2007 as compared to 2006 was also primarily due to the restructuring partially offset by the $0.8 million in non-recurring restructuring expenses and the non-cash charge of $1.4 million for the repurchase and subsequent cancellation of certain stock options held by Company executives, both of which occurred in the first quarter of 2007. General and administrative expenses totaled $5.7 million and $17.7 million during the third quarter and nine months ended September 30, 2007, compared to $4.0 million and $11.6 million during the same periods of 2006. This increase in expenses primarily reflects the transaction advisory costs we accrued in the third quarter of 2007 in connection with our proposed merger with Evotec AG, the majority of which will be paid upon the closing of the transaction which is currently expected in the first quarter of 2008. These costs were partially offset by the lower costs stemming from the restructuring in January 2007. The increase in the nine months ended September 30, 2007 was primarily due to the non-cash charge of $5.9 million related to the stock option cancellation program, as well as the transaction advisory costs noted above. The net loss for the third quarter of 2007 was $9.1 million compared to $7.4 million in the third quarter of 2006. The net loss for the nine months ended September 30, 2007 was $26.0 million compared to $20.4 million for the same period last year. Basic and diluted net loss per share in the quarter and nine months ended September 30, 2007, was $0.31 and $0.88 compared to $0.25 and $0.70 in the comparable periods in 2006. At September 30, 2007, Renovis had $85.7 million in cash, cash equivalents and short-term investments. About Renovis Renovis is a biopharmaceutical company focused on the discovery and development of drugs for major medical needs in the areas of neurological and inflammatory diseases. The Company's proprietary research programs focus on the purinergic receptors, P2X3 and P2X7, for the potential treatment of pain and inflammatory diseases. In addition, Renovis has a worldwide collaboration and license agreement with Pfizer to research, develop and commercialize small molecule vanilloid receptor (VR1) antagonists and an agreement with Genentech, Inc. in the areas of nerve growth and anti-angiogenesis.
